Step 1: Understand the Rules
Before you even sit down at a virtual table, take a moment to familiarise yourself with the basic rules of blackjack:
- The goal is to beat the dealer’s hand without going over **21**.
- Cards 2-10 are worth their face value, while face cards (Kings, Queens, Jacks) are worth **10**, and Aces can be worth **1** or **11**.
- You can choose to hit (take another card), stand (keep your hand), double down (double your bet after the first two cards), or split (if you have two cards of the same value).
Understanding these rules is essential as they form the foundation for your strategy.
Step 2: Practice Basic Strategy
Utilising a basic strategy chart can significantly improve your odds. This chart provides the best moves based on your hand versus the dealer’s upcard. Here’s a simplified version:
| Your Hand | Dealer’s Upcard | Best Move |
|---|---|---|
| 8 or less | Any | Hit |
| 9 | 3-6 | Double Down |
| 10 | 2-9 | Double Down |
| 11 | Any | Double Down |
| 12-16 | 2-6 | Stand |
| 17 or higher | Any | Stand |
Practising this strategy in free games can help you commit these moves to memory before you wager real money.
Step 3: Manage Your Bankroll
Effective bankroll management is crucial. Here are a few tips:
- Set a clear budget for each session and stick to it.
- Divide your bankroll into smaller portions to avoid overspending in one go.
- Avoid chasing losses; it’s better to walk away than to risk more than you’re comfortable losing.
One thing I’d flag: having a well-defined limit can help you enjoy the game without the stress of overspending.
